Phreesia, Inc. $PHR Shares Purchased by Arcadia Investment Management Corp MI

Arcadia Investment Management Corp MI boosted its holdings in Phreesia, Inc. (NYSE:PHRFree Report) by 22.3% during the 2nd qu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 113,470 shares of the company’s stock after buying an additional 20,700 shares during the quarter. Arcadia Investment Management Corp MI owned approximately 0.19% of Phreesia worth $3,229,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Phreesia Stock Performance

NYSE:PHR opened at $21.77 on Friday. The firm’s fifty day simple moving average is $23.36 and its 200-day simple moving average is $25.82. The company has a quick ratio of 2.12, a current ratio of 2.12 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.02. The stock has a market cap of $1.30 billion, a PE ratio of -51.84 and a beta of 0.74. Phreesia, Inc. has a fifty-two week low of $17.07 and a fifty-two week high of $32.76.

Phreesia (NYSE:PHRG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, September 4th. The company reported $0.01 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of ($0.07) by $0.08. Phreesia had a negative net margin of 5.35% and a negative return on equity of 8.75%. The firm had revenue of $117.26 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$116.39 million.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m earned ($0.03) earnings per share. The firm’s revenue was up 14.9% on a year-over-year basis. Phreesia has set its FY 2026 guidance at EPS. Analysts expect that Phreesia, Inc. will post -1.1 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Phreesia Company Profile

Phreesia, Inc provides an integrated SaaS-based software and payment platform for the healthcare industry in the United States and Canada. The company offers access solutions that offers appointment scheduling system for online appointments, reminders, and referral tracking management; registration solution to automate patient self-registration; revenue cycle solution, which offer insurance-verification processes, point-of-sale payments applications, post-visit payment collection, and flexible payment options; and network connect solution to deliver clinically relevant content to patients.
